Abstract

The invention provides a dynamic carrier management method, which comprises the following steps of: for any cell managed by a radio network controller (RNC), correspondingly storing NPriNb, NSecNb and NPotentialNb for each carrier i of the cell by using the RNC, wherein NPriNb is the number of primary carriers at the same frequency with the carrier i in all neighbor cells of the cell, NSecNb is the number of established secondary carriers at the same frequency with the carrier i in all the neighbor cells of the cell, and NPotentialNb is the number of unestablished secondary carriers at the same frequency with the carrier i in all the neighbor cells of the cell; and in the addition and deletion of the carriers of the cell, calculating the interference of corresponding carriers in a network according to the NPriNb, the NSecNb and the NPotentialNb, selecting a carrier with the lowest interference for addition, and selecting a carrier with the highest interference for deletion, thereby minimizing the interference in the neighbor cells in the addition and deletion of the carriers.

Embodiment
For making purpose of the present invention, technological means and advantage clearer, below in conjunction with accompanying drawing, the present invention is described in further details.
Network, when initial plan, can be planned to alien frequencies by the main carrier of each residential quarter, but can't avoid main carrier or the same frequency of auxiliary carrier wave of the auxiliary carrier wave in residential quarter and adjacent area.Therefore, carrier wave of the every increase in residential quarter, the user who accesses this carrier wave likely brings co-channel interference to adjacent area, and if when the main carrier of the carrier wave that increases and adjacent area occurs with frequency, to the interference maximum of adjacent area.
Based on this, basic thought of the present invention is: when cell carrier changes, and the interference size that the carrier wave that calculate to increase or reduce may bring adjacent area, thus select to disturb minimum carrier wave to increase, select to disturb maximum carrier wave to delete.
In the present invention, RNC safeguards N for each carrier wave of each cell configuration in advance PriNb, N SecNbAnd N PotentialNb, three values calculate initial value when cell initial is set up, and afterwards, three values will dynamically be adjusted according to increase and the minimizing of adjacent area carrier wave.
Think the N of the carrier wave i maintenance of certain cell configuration PriNb, N SecNbAnd N PotentialNbThe N that illustrates for example PriNb, N SecNbAnd N PotentialNbImplication, N PriNbFor in all adjacent areas of certain residential quarter, with carrier wave i, being the main carrier number with frequently, N SecNbFor in all adjacent areas of certain residential quarter, with carrier wave i, being with frequently and the auxiliary carrier number of having set up, N PotentialNbFor in all adjacent areas of certain residential quarter, with carrier wave i, being with unfounded auxiliary carrier number frequently and still.
In the present invention, according to above-mentioned three values, can calculate the interference I of corresponding carriers to network.Concrete account form is:
I=I Pri+I Sec+I potential
I Pri=α×N PriNb
I sec=β×N SecNb
I potential=γ×N PotentialNb
Wherein, I PriFor carrier wave i to the interference of all adjacent area main carriers and, I SecFor carrier wave i to the interference of all auxiliary carrier waves in adjacent area and, I PotentialFor carrier wave i to the potential interference of all adjacent areas and (certain neighbor cell configuration identical carrier wave, but this carrier wave is not yet set up).α, beta, gamma: three kinds of dissimilar interference I of 3 Parametric Representations Pri, I SecAnd I PotentialRespectively to the influence degree of network, α, beta, gamma can dynamic-configuration, and because the interference of main carrier frequency is disturbed greater than assistant carrier frequency, the carrier frequency of having set up disturbs greater than potential carrier frequency and disturbs, so α>β>γ.α, the concrete value of beta, gamma can be determined by emulation mode, and can further in the network operation process, dynamically adjust.
As mentioned above, in the present invention, RNC is the corresponding N of preservation of each carrier wave of the configuration of each residential quarter PriNb, N SecNbAnd N PotentialNb, when carrying out carrier wave increase or deletion, utilize aforesaid way to carry out the interference calculation of carrier wave to network, and then select carrier wave increase or delete according to result of calculation.Below introduce respectively the idiographic flow while specifically carrying out carrier wave increase and deletion.
